For such processes, the counter field is ignored by the scheduler in favour of the rt_priority field. Thus, even though the actual priority is available via sched_getparam(2), the priority in /proc//stat -- and, consequently, in the output of ps(1) and top(1) -- seems to be, for SCHED_FIFO/SCHED_RR processes, a value that is not representative at all of how the process is scheduled. I have thrown together a patch to address this, but I can't say I feel entirely comfortable about scaling from 1..99 to -20..20. Any comments would be appreciated.
